PDFKey Pro
PDFKey Pro is a utility designed to unlock password-protected PDFs, offering a solution for users who need access to restricted documents. It is particularly useful for professionals and individuals who encounter forgotten passwords or need to remove restrictions for editing purposes.
PDFKey Pro removes passwords from protected PDF files, allowing users to access and edit them without the original password.
Pros
- + Effectively bypasses forgotten passwords for PDF access
- + Does not require user registration, protecting privacy
- + Native macOS integration for seamless use
Cons
- - Lack of auto-updates may require manual checks for new versions
- - Niche functionality limits appeal to a broader audience
RWTS PDFwriter
RWTS PDFwriter is a macOS print driver that allows users to print documents directly to a PDF file. It offers a seamless integration with macOS printing system, making it easy to convert any printable document into a PDF without additional steps. Ideal for users who frequently need to create PDFs from various applications.
RWTS PDFwriter acts as a print driver, enabling users to save documents directly as PDF files from any application that supports printing.
Pros
- + Seamless integration with macOS printing system
- + Saves documents directly as PDFs without additional steps
- + Customizable print settings for PDF output
Cons
- - No auto-update feature
- - Some users report minor interface issues
